Wyoming is a main southwestern suburb of Grand Rapids. It grew
from a small town until January 1, 1959, when it was incorporated as a
city. It was given a post office in 1960. It is bordered on the north by
Grand Rapids, on the south by 60th Street, on the east by Division Ave.
and on the west by Grandville. A major feature of this area is the
careful blending of urban life with nature, as evidenced by the
locations of Palmer Park, the Buck Creek Nature Area and Lamar Park -
amid residential neighborhoods. Both are great places to take a walk "in
the country" without having to travel to the county. Palmer Park
includes 3 hiking trails, a golf course and several picnic areas. Lamar
Park includes picnic areas and a pond open for swimming in the summer.
